Their Love Story Begins
Casey and Brielle first met while both working at the YMCA. Casey had been working as the youth sports coordinator at the time, while Brielle had just started working part-time at the front desk, specifically on the weekends. While it was not typical for Casey to be at the YMCA on the weekends, he did occasionally spend Saturdays coordinating the youth basketball games. One weekend, Brielle was at the front desk by herself and was surprised when Casey introduced himself. While it seemed casual at the time, Brielle now knows just how significant it is that he initiated the conversation. Ever since that day, Casey and Brielle have been best friends!
The Proposal
One weekend, Casey and Brielle decided to take an adventure to Newport on the Oregon coast. Casey had planned the entire weekend, and the couple’s first destination was the Yaquina Head Lighthouse! First built in 1778, the Yaquina Head Lighthouse, formerly known as the Cape Foulweather Lighthouse, is the tallest tower on the Oregon Coast, standing at 93 ft tall!
While exploring this one-of-a-kind landmark, Casey suggested that he and Brielle stop at a lookout to watch for whales. Being from landlocked Montana, Brielle, not knowing if spotting a whale from shore was a possibility, contently stared out to sea. When she turned around to say something to Casey, she found him on one knee with a stunning ring in a velvet pink box in hand.

Casey and Brielle’s wedding ceremony was hosted in the backyard of the home where Brielle grew up.
Based in Missoula, MT, Casey and Brielle had the most wonderful backyard wedding ceremony under Montana’s big sky. Often referred to as the “hub of five valleys”, due to the city being at the convergence of five mountain ranges, we truly believe this Missoula is such a beautiful location for anyone big day. Aside from the stunning landscapes surrounding this town, Missoula is known for its culture. From its diverse mix of college students to hippies, sports fans, and retirees, Missoula is such a wonderful place to call home!
In addition to being hosted in her childhood home, Brielle’s father officiated the wedding. We can’t even begin to explain how emotional it must’ve been for him as he officially announced his beloved daughter and new son-in-law as married for the very first time!
